1. As demographics shift, downtown Anchorage businesses adjust to attract younger customers (adn.com) — Downtown Anchorage businesses are rethinking nightlife to win back younger residents, from concert producers recommitting to Town Square Park to restaurants expanding mocktail menus and collaborations. Local entrepreneurs describe how social media, changing drinking habits, and event-focused outings are reshaping where and how Anchorage's 20-somethings spend their evenings, and why supporting downtown venues now matters for the city's cultural future.

2. Anchorage overdose dispatches surged over past five years, public records reveal (ktuu.com) — Anchorage residents are seeing a sharp rise in opioid overdose calls, with more than 2,000 suspected overdose dispatches projected again this year, heavily involving the Anchorage Fire Department. New reporting methods reveal the depth of the crisis, while a Mobile Integrated Health program now starts treatment and connects people to recovery services directly in the community to break the cycle of repeat emergencies.

3. Forget jets and helicopters. Data centers could be Alaska military towns' next noisy neighbors (alaskapublic.org) — Military planners are considering building new data centers near Anchorage, Healy, and Fairbanks, potentially adding constant industrial noise and major power demand to nearby communities. Alaska leaders and residents are raising concerns about already high energy costs, strained utilities, and limited local control over Pentagon decisions on federal land. Anchorage-area readers may see long-term impacts on power reliability, costs, and neighborhood character.

4. New details of fatal Seldovia plane crash released by investigators (alaskasnewssource.com) — Investigators have released preliminary findings on last month's fatal crash of a Piper PA-24 that departed Anchorage's Merrill Field for Seldovia, killing four people. Witnesses in Seldovia described a fast, bouncing landing attempt, a steep climb, and the plane striking a tree before ending up submerged in Seldovia Slough, with a detailed wreckage examination still pending.

5. Prelim report of Cape Newenham plane crash that killed all 8 reveals new details (alaskasnewssource.com) — A fatal August plane crash that killed eight people at Cape Newenham is now detailed in a preliminary federal report, which notes the aircraft departed Ted Stevens Anchorage International Airport. Investigators say dense fog, near-zero visibility, and a hazardous mountain-slope approach contributed to the Cessna's failed landing attempts, though an official cause may take more than a year to finalize.
